PHS Band Boosters Fundraiser Car Wash at IHOP

Parsippany, NJLocal News

The Parsippany High School Band Boosters will hold their Annual Summer Car Wash on August 16, 2025, from 9:00 a. m. to 2:00 p. m. at IHOP located on U.

S. Route 46. For a fee of $5 per car, residents can have their vehicles cleaned while contributing to the band’s hospitality needs, competition snacks, and annual banquet. The Band Boosters are encouraging community involvement, emphasizing that local support is essential for the band’s ongoing success.
